...An obvious person to ask for help on understanding how to deal with introverts is fellow extrovert Professor Karl Moore of McGill University, whose work on the treatment of introverts in the corporate environment has gained much attention, including in this popular Economist article. He combines real-world experience with academic thinking, which has led him to publish 28 refereed journal articles and ten books, leading to over 1,950 Google Scholar cites. Currently, he is working on his next book “Quiet Leaders: Introverts in the Executive Suite.” I am delighted that he agreed to share a few thoughts with s on how extroverts can be more mindful of the differences between them and the introverts in their lives and how to make our interactions more enjoyable.
